Autenticação & Token
Para começar a utilizar a API do Jimmy.Chat e disparar mensagens via WhatsApp, você precisa obter um token de autenticação. Esse token é essencial para garantir a segurança e a autenticidade de suas requisições à API. Siga os passos abaixo para solicitar e utilizar o token de autenticação:
Passo 1: Preparação das Credenciais
Antes de solicitar um token de autenticação, você precisará ter as credenciais de usuário e senha do Jimmy.Chat. Certifique-se de que essas credenciais estão corretas e prontas para uso.
Passo 2: Solicitação do Token de Autenticação
Para solicitar o token de autenticação, você precisará realizar uma requisição HTTP POST para a URL apropriada. A URL de solicitação do token é fornecida pela equipe do Jimmy.Chat e geralmente se parece com algo assim:
Corpo da Requisição:
No corpo da requisição POST, você precisará fornecer as seguintes informações:
- Usuário e Senha:Inclua suas credenciais de usuário(email) e senha como parte dos dados da requisição. Este usuário deve ser do tipo Administrador no Jimmy Chat. Exemplo:
Passo 3: Recebimento do Token
Após enviar a requisição POST com suas credenciais, o servidor do Jimmy.Chat processará a solicitação e, se as credenciais forem válidas, retornará um token de autenticação em uma resposta. O token será incluído no corpo da resposta, geralmente no formato JSON. Por exemplo:
- access_token: Este é o token de autenticação que você utilizará em suas requisições futuras à API.
- token_type: Indica o tipo de token, que é geralmente "Bearer" no caso da API do Jimmy.Chat.
- expires_in: Esse valor representa o tempo de validade do token em segundos. Lembre-se de que o token expirará após um período definido, portanto, é importante estar ciente disso na sua integração.
Passo 4: Utilização do Token
Agora que você obteve com sucesso o token de autenticação, você deve incluí-lo no cabeçalho de suas requisições futuras à API. O cabeçalho de autorização deve ser definido da seguinte maneira:
Certifique-se de que o token esteja sempre presente nas suas requisições para autenticar-se com a API.
Observação:
- Como mencionado, o token de autenticação expirará após um período de tempo especificado (geralmente em segundos, como indicado em